G-Force goes 4-2 at the MMA Bigshow
It was a good night for the team as 6 hungry mma fighters stepped into the cage ready to show the fans the next generation of G-Force fighters. Newcomer Mike Dabe has been anxious to get in the cage and show his teammates he had what it takes to represent Team G-Force and mma in cincinnati as well as continue the reputation the team carries for being one of the most aggressive fight clubs around. Mike got the night started off with a rear naked choke in the first round. Manager/Trainer (Mr.G) Ron Gabelman said “We’ve all been anxious to see Dabe get in the cage he trains real hard all the time and he’s improved so much since starting mma training just 6 months ago, he suffered a little adrenaline dump after the fight but thats typical for an amateur, thats why we call it getting their cherry popped. Mikes gonna be a top contender in the 185lb division.” Veteran G-Force fighter and original member Joe Pegg started of with a Bang landing a nice solid round kick to his opponents face before getting taken down. Joe pulled guard and nearly sunk a triangle but his opponent was able to pass in Joe quickly turned to his side but exposed a little to much of his back and was caught in a rear naked choke. Joe loves to stand up and bang but nobody ever wants to stay up with him once they get kicked in the face with his sweet dreams foot the always want to take him down, Joe normally fights 135 but since no 135’s were available he decided to fight up a weight class to get in on the MMA Bigshow. Next up for G-Force was fighter Jake Larter after opening up with a nice combination on his opponent Ricky Phillips. Phillips shot in for a single leg. Jake stuffed the takedown and pulled guard Phillips unleashed a birage of punches inside Jakes guard. Larter covered up and Phillips passed Jakes guard and moved into mount throwing more punches. Larter covered up again and reversed Phillips mount to end up in his guard. With only 30 seconds left in the round Jake unloaded his fury on Phillips until the bell rang. Phillips couldn’t answer the bell for the second round and Larter takes home the win. Last minute replacement Quinton Simpson stepped up to fight the heavy hands of Dominick Steele. Quinton only had 2 weeks to prepare for the fight and did well considering the experience and power of Steele losing to him in the first round.
